 What's it all about?....  I'm off to the Arctic to embark on a walk to the Magnetic North Pole. I'll be part of a team of five, none of us with any previous Arctic experience and pulling all our food, kit, tents and fuel on sledges. Temperatures will range between -20C to -65C and we may well encounter the odd Polar Bear on the way.

Training for the event has included a weekend of team building tasks and camping in the lake district in November last year - which happened to be the same weekend all those bridges were washed away! 4 days training, camping and skiing in Norway in January (that was seriously cold - but not as cold as the North Pole) plus cold weather injury training and shotgun training (just in case the Polar Bears get too friendly) in March. In addition, I have to make sure I can physically handle the event, so I've spent a lot of time pulling tyres, swimming and running.

This expedition is dragging me out of my comfort zone and is testing me to my (limited) limit. I hate the cold and all forms of discomfort and I will have to survive without real coffee or any alcohol for the entire trip. Not to mention sleeping in a small tent with two large hairy guys! Why Rainbows Young Childrens Hospice...Sadly, some children simply do not live long enough. Rainbows is a hospice for children and young people which deserves all the support it can get.  Since opening in 1994, Rainbows has provided a sanctuary where life-limited children and their families can take a break from problems, fully supported and cared for by an incredible professional team. They help relieve symptoms, improve the quality of life, support parents and siblings through the darkest of bereavements and care for children until the end.
